XML 15 R2.htm IDEA: XBRL DOCUMENT v3.24.3
Condensed Consolidated Balance Sheets - USD ($)
$ in Thousands
Sep. 30, 2024
Dec. 31, 2023
Current assets    
Cash $ 9,013 $ 9,175
Accounts receivable, net    
Trade - billed (less allowances of approximately $907 and $806, respectively), including contract retentions 17,822 17,209
Trade - unbilled 914 525
Inventories, net    
Raw materials 2,244 2,329
Finished goods 3,998 2,821
Refundable income taxes 23 0
Prepaid expenses 979 1,266
Total current assets 34,993 33,325
Property and equipment, net 31,189 27,680
Other assets 444 343
Total assets 66,626 61,348
Current liabilities    
Accounts payable - trade 5,427 7,336
Accrued expenses and other liabilities 852 831
Deferred revenue 2,792 2,717
Accrued compensation 1,381 1,203
Accrued income taxes 0 473
Operating lease liabilities 13 43
Current maturities of notes payable 651 636
Customer deposits 1,492 2,779
Total current liabilities 12,608 16,018
Deferred revenue 7,401 4,424
Operating lease liabilities 0 2
Notes payable - less current maturities 4,630 5,092
Deferred tax liability 1,650 1,651
Total liabilities 26,289 27,187
Stockholders' equity    
Preferred stock, $.01 par value; authorized 1,000,000 shares, none issued and outstanding 0 0
Common stock, $.01 par value; authorized 8,000,000 shares; 5,345,759 and 5,349,599 issued and 5,304,839 and 5,308,679 outstanding, respectively 54 54
Additional paid-in capital 7,712 7,814
Treasury stock, at cost, 40,920 shares (102) (102)
Retained earnings 32,673 26,395
Total stockholders' equity 40,337 34,161
Total liabilities and stockholders' equity $ 66,626 $ 61,348